RN - Neuro ICU
Job Details:
* Work 3x12-hour night shifts per week
* Patient ratio of 2:1 on days, nights, and weekends
* Float required to ICU, IMC, and Tele units as needed
* Half of weekends per contract required
* One pre-approved time off request allowed
* 2 years of experience preferred
* Travel experience preferred
* Neuro ICU experience required
* Trauma Level I and Level II experience preferred
* Community hospital experience preferred
* Charting in Epic required
* Required certifications: ACLS, BLS, NIHSS
* Required skills include: blood product administration, care of ventilated patient, central line care/management, CVA/acute stroke management, external ventricular drain (EVD), hypothermia protocol/Arctic Sun, ICP monitoring, interpretation and management of dysrhythmias, lumbar drains, post craniotomy, post neurosurgery management, spinal cord injury, and traumatic brain injury
* Treats adult patient population
* Unit includes 14 rooms and 16 beds with a daily census of 14
* Interdisciplinary support available including IV teams, physical therapy, respiratory services, interpretation services, phlebotomy, radiology, social services, rapid response teams, pharmacy, and unit secretary
